How the mortar estimate is calculated
Mortar follows from how many units you’re laying and how thick the joints are. The calculator starts from your brick or block count, applies the mortar per unit, scales for joint thickness, and adds waste. Here is the exact math.
Worked example — 1,500 modular bricks at a 3/8″ joint
Bags rule: 1,500 ÷ 1000 × 7 = 10.5
Round up: → 11 bags of premixed mortar
Check: 1,500 ÷ ~125 per bag ≈ 12 bags (the two rules bracket the same answer)
≈ 11 bags of 80 lb premixed mortar for 1,500 bricks at a standard joint — add waste and round up.
Mortar estimating charts
Handy lookups for the questions people ask most — bags by brick and block count, how the joint changes it, and which mortar type to use. Figures assume a 3/8-inch joint and premixed 80 lb bags, so confirm your own mix.
| Bricks (modular) | Mortar bags | Rough sand (site mix) |
|---|---|---|
| 250 | 2 bags | ~0.25 ton |
| 500 | 4 bags | ~0.5 ton |
| 1,000 | 7 bags | ~1 ton |
| 1,500 | 11 bags | ~1.5 tons |
| 2,000 | 14 bags | ~2 tons |
| 3,000 | 21 bags | ~3 tons |
About 7 bags of premixed mortar per 1,000 bricks. Sand figures are rough guides only if you’re site-mixing from cement and lime instead of buying premix.
| Blocks (8″ CMU) | Mortar bags |
|---|---|
| 50 | 2 bags |
| 100 | 3 bags |
| 200 | 6 bags |
| 300 | 9 bags |
| 500 | 15 bags |
About 3 bags per 100 standard blocks. Blocks are large, so one bag lays only ~33 of them versus ~125 bricks — don’t reuse a per-brick rule for block.
| Joint thickness | Mortar factor | Notes |
|---|---|---|
| 1/4″ joint | ~0.67× | Tight joints; about a third less mortar |
| 3/8″ joint | 1.0× | The standard baseline |
| 1/2″ joint | ~1.33× | Wider joints; about a third more mortar |
| 5/8″ joint | ~1.67× | Rustic / rough work; lots more mortar |
Mortar scales roughly with the joint, so consistent joints keep both the look and the estimate reliable. Set your joint in the calculator before ordering.
| Type | Strength | Best for |
|---|---|---|
| Type N | Medium | General above-grade walls, veneers, chimneys |
| Type S | High | Below-grade, foundations, structural walls |
| Type M | Highest | Heavy loads, retaining walls, driveways |
| Type O | Low | Interior, non-load-bearing, repointing soft brick |
Most homes use Type N or S. Match the type to the job and code rather than always picking the strongest — an over-hard mortar can damage softer masonry over time.

Mortar isn’t measured by the brick alone — three things move the total, and the calculator handles each.
- Brick vs block — a bag lays ~125 bricks but only ~33 blocks, so the unit type matters.
- Joint thickness — a 1/2″ joint uses about a third more mortar than a 3/8″ one.
- Waste — mortar drops off the trowel and stiffens, so 10–15% is normal to add.

Estimate mortar from how many bricks or blocks you’re laying. A common rule is about 7 bags of mortar mix per 1,000 modular bricks, or about 3 bags per 100 standard blocks, at a 3/8-inch joint.
For 1,500 bricks that’s roughly 11 bags. Thicker joints, rougher units, and waste all push the number up, so it’s worth rounding up and keeping a spare bag.
An 80 lb bag of premixed mortar lays roughly 125 modular bricks or about 33 standard 8-inch blocks at a normal 3/8-inch joint.
Blocks are much larger than bricks, so a bag covers far fewer of them. The exact yield depends on the mix brand, the joint thickness, and how much mortar ends up wasted, so treat these as planning figures.
Joint thickness is a major driver of how much mortar you use. The standard is 3/8 inch, and mortar scales roughly in proportion to the joint.
A 1/2-inch joint uses about a third more mortar than a 3/8-inch joint, while a 1/4-inch joint uses about a third less. Keeping joints consistent both looks better and makes your mortar estimate reliable.
Mortar is graded by strength. Type N is a general-purpose mix for most above-grade walls; Type S is stronger for below-grade and structural work; Type M is the strongest, for foundations and heavy loads; and Type O is a soft, low-strength mix for interior, non-load-bearing walls.
Most home projects use Type N or Type S. Match the type to the job and the local code rather than defaulting to the strongest, since an over-strong mortar can actually harm softer masonry.
If you mix mortar on site from Portland cement and lime, you’ll add sand at roughly a 3-to-1 sand-to-cement ratio by volume, which is a lot of sand for a big job.
Many DIY and small jobs instead use premixed mortar in a bag, which already contains the sand — you just add water. The calculator can estimate bags of premix, or cement, lime, and sand for a site mix.
For standard 8 by 8 by 16 inch concrete blocks, plan on about 3 bags of mortar mix per 100 blocks at a 3/8-inch joint, so 200 blocks needs roughly 6 bags.
Blocks use mortar only on their face shells, not a full bed, but their large size still means a bag covers only about 33 of them. Add waste and round up so you don’t stop mid-course.
Add about 10% to 15% for mortar that drops off the trowel, sticks to the mixer and board, or stiffens before it can be used. Mortar is wasted more readily than the units themselves.
Mix only what you can lay in about an hour or two before it starts to set, since re-tempering has limits. It’s normal to lose a meaningful share of each batch, so build that into the order.
No. Mortar begins to set once water is added and should be used within about 90 minutes to two hours, so mix it fresh on the day and only in batches you can lay in that window.
You can re-temper slightly stiffened mortar once by adding a little water, but not after it has begun to harden. Never use mortar that has started to set, since it won’t bond properly.
